A Supplement to the annual appropriations act for the fiscal year ending June 30, 2025, P.L.2024, c.22.
Be It Enacted by the Senate and the General Assembly of the State of New Jersey:
1. In addition to the amounts appropriated under P.L.2024, c.22, the annual appropriations act for the fiscal year ending June 30, 2025, there is appropriated from the General Fund the following amount for the purpose specified:
66 DEPARTMENT OF LAW AND PUBLIC SAFETY
10 Public Safety and Criminal Justice
19 Central Planning, Direction and Management
GRANTS-IN-AID
13-1005 Homeland Security and Preparedness .............. $10,000,000
Total Grants-in-Aid Appropriation,
Central Planning, Direction and Management $10,000,000
Grants-in-Aid:
13 Unmanned Aircraft Systems Grant Program ($10,000,000)
2. This act shall take effect immediately.
STATEMENT
The bill supplements the FY2025 appropriations act by appropriating $10 million to the Office of Homeland Security and Preparedness to create a grant program for State and local officials to purchase equipment or training necessary to address sightings of unidentifiable Unmanned Aircraft Systems (UAS), also known as drones.
The recent surge in mass sightings of UAS and unexplained usage of this technology in national airspace is disconcerting to the citizens of New Jersey and a potential threat to critical infrastructure.
This supplemental appropriation provides needed funds to support State and local law enforcement in safeguarding vital assets and ensuring strict adherence to all regulations and requirements associated with UAS ownership and operation in New Jersey.
